November 2, 2012 – BDF is pleased to announce that a federal district court in Michigan ruled in favor of preliminarily enjoining the coercive HHS Mandate against a Catholic business owner and his business.
- In that case, BDF attorneys Nikolas T. Nikas and Dorinda C. Bordlee filed an amicus brief along with LLDF in favor of the plaintiff business and the Legatus organization.

October 12, 2012 – BDF attorneys and our co-counsel at LLDF also filed an amicus brief on behalf of Women Speak for Themselves in support of Belmont Abbey and Wheaton College. Read the brief outlining how the HHS completely ignored medical evidence of serious increased health risks when erroneously and coercively classifying hormonal contraceptives and abortifacient drugs as mandatory “women’s preventive healthcare.”
